> I have a 2 nodes cluster and I need to drop the main keyspace. When I execute 'drop keyspace xxxx', I receive the following affirmation:
> Cluster schema does not yet agree
> And I don't know what to do to have the drop really executed .... i repeat the drop and i keep getting the same message.
